package org.arquillian.cube.openshift.impl.client; import io.fabric8.kubernetes.api.model.v2_2.HasMetadata; import io.fabric8.kubernetes.api.model.v2_2.Pod; import io.fabric8.kubernetes.api.model.v2_2.Service; import java.io.ByteArrayInputStream; import java.io.File; import java.io.FileInputStream; import java.io.FileNotFoundException; import java.io.InputStream; import java.nio.charset.StandardCharsets; import org.arquillian.cube.kubernetes.api.Configuration; import org.arquillian.cube.openshift.impl.model.BuildablePodCube; import org.arquillian.cube.openshift.impl.model.ServiceCube; import org.arquillian.cube.spi.CubeRegistry; import org.jboss.arquillian.core.api.Injector; import org.jboss.arquillian.core.api.annotation.Observes; public class CubeOpenShiftRegistrar { public void register(@Observes final OpenShiftClient client, final CubeRegistry registry, final Configuration conf, final Injector injector) { if (!(conf instanceof CubeOpenShiftConfiguration)) { return; } CubeOpenShiftConfiguration configuration = (CubeOpenShiftConfiguration) conf; if (!hasDefinitionStream(configuration)) { return; } for (HasMetadata item : client.getClientExt().load(getDefinitionStream(configuration)).get()) { if (item instanceof Pod) { registry.addCube(injector.inject(new BuildablePodCube((Pod) item, client, configuration))); } else if (item instanceof Service) { registry.addCube(injector.inject(new ServiceCube((Service) item, client, configuration))); } } } private boolean hasDefinitionStream(CubeOpenShiftConfiguration conf) { return conf.getDefinitions() != null || (conf.getDefinitionsFile() != null && new File( conf.getDefinitionsFile()).exists()); } private InputStream getDefinitionStream(CubeOpenShiftConfiguration conf) { try { if (conf.getDefinitions() != null && !conf.getDefinitions().isEmpty()) { return new ByteArrayInputStream(conf.getDefinitions().getBytes(StandardCharsets.UTF_8)); } else if (conf.getDefinitionsFile() != null && !conf.getDefinitionsFile().isEmpty()) { return new FileInputStream(conf.getDefinitionsFile()); } } catch (FileNotFoundException e) { throw new IllegalArgumentException("No definitions file found at " + conf.getDefinitionsFile()); } //We've already check both throw new IllegalStateException("Neither definitions nor definitionsFile has been configured."); } }
